#19ce38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19ce38 is composed of 9.8% red, 80.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 130.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 45.3%. #19ce38 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ff70 with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#19ce38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19ce38 has RGB values of R:25, G:206,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1691192.

Shades and Tints of #19ce38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e04 is the darkest color, while #fbfffc is the lightest one.
